Children’s Day is the result of the long-time dream of Loveland resident Annie Hall, who lived for 100 years as the biggest fan of children and who believed that children deserved a day totally dedicated to celebration and enjoyment and their spirit. With Annie’s request, Colorado Senator Stan Matsunaka sponsored Senate Joint Resolution 01-015 in March 2001, which created a Colorado Children’s Day to be celebrated each year in March. The resolution was unanimously passed by the Colorado legislature. The City of Loveland, in cooperation with Thompson School District, has been celebrating Colorado Children’s Day since 2002 and the event is still celebrated in Loveland each March in Annie’s memory.
